Output d55a60a54b5e21d237536a744415b48150b7ddc9b9d5c4a82cf1343d6dc81708:3

value
223092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28cd6c04c66d5de4532b5b7a52da74feffcea366 OP_EQUAL
address
35Qm3BdfdRQaSdvbpQySF3Tvx3c7KeHuFf
transaction
d55a60a54b5e21d237536a744415b48150b7ddc9b9d5c4a82cf1343d6dc81708
confirmations
304475
spent
true